Senior Infrastructure Architect

At Genmab, we are building something transformative, and like any strong structure, it starts with a solid foundation. We are looking for an Senior Infrastructure Architect who can act as the bridge between business needs, technical infrastructure, and cloud security, someone who understands the full journey from laptop to cloud.

Your Role

As our Senior Infrastructure Architect, you won't just design IT systems, you will build the roadmap that brings together people, processes, and technology. This role combines hands-on expertise, strategic oversight, and stakeholder engagement to guide how we deliver secure and scalable infrastructure, both on-premises and in the cloud (Azure, AWS, SaaS).

You will work closely with engineering, business teams, and external partners, helping translate business needs into solid, secure, and future-proof architecture. Think of it as building a house: you will ensure the structure is sound, the plumbing secure, and the tech stack aligned, whether we are expanding an office, moving to the cloud, or enabling a new lab setup.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and lead infrastructure solutions across cloud, lab, and corporate systems.
  • Build secure and scalable architectures in Azure, AWS, and hybrid environments.
  • Translate business and security needs into technical architecture.
  • Be a day-to-day consultant: meet with internal stakeholders (engineers, business, vendors) and guide project decisions.
  • Engage with a fixed list of ongoing projects and support office expansions from an IT infrastructure standpoint.
  • Set cloud governance and security best practices, you will be the one ensuring our structure is sound.
  • Participate in CAB (Change Advisory Board) meetings to present architecture decisions.
  • Mentor and guide the team, which includes 12 direct colleagues and around 150 consultants.
  • Speak up, whether it's making a case for a solution or explaining how things connect, we value someone who can communicate clearly and compellingly.

Who You Are

  • A true consultative architect, someone who sees the big picture and knows how to bring people together around it.
  • Comfortable in meetings, confident in presenting, and curious enough to ask "why?".
  • Not afraid to challenge assumptions with thoughtful technical arguments.
  • Strong in stakeholder communication - from engineers to vendors to leadership.
  • Well-versed in IT, security, and modern infrastructure topics including SSO, IAM, Zero Trust, IaC (e.g., Terraform), networking, Windows, Azure AD, and SaaS platforms.

Requirements

  • Minimum 8 years of technical infrastructure experience, with a proven track into architecture.
  • Hands-on background, not just PowerPoint-level architecture.
  • Located in Denmark and able to work onsite at our office.
  • Strong experience with cloud (Azure, AWS), SaaS, Microsoft systems, and security architecture.
  • Comfortable bridging technical knowledge with business objectives.
  • Certifications such as Azure Solutions Architect Expert, AWS Certified Architect, or ITIL are a bonus.

About Genmab

Genmab is an international biotechnology company with a core purpose to improve the lives of patients through innovative and differentiated antibody therapeutics. For 25 years, its hard-working, innovative and collaborative team has invented next-generation antibody technology platforms and harnessed translational, quantitative and data sciences, resulting in a proprietary pipeline including bispecific T-cell engagers, antibody-drug conjugates, next-generation immune checkpoint modulators and effector function-enhanced antibodies. By 2030, Genmab's vision is to transform the lives of people with cancer and other serious diseases with Knock-Your-Socks-Off (KYSO®) antibody medicines.

Established in 1999, Genmab is headquartered in Copenhagen, Denmark with international presence across North America, Europe and Asia Pacific. For more information, please visit Genmab.com and follow us on LinkedIn and X.
